Garage Crack Repair Questions
What causes garage cracks? Garage cracks can result from soil movement, temperature changes, or settling foundations over time.
Are all garage cracks a sign of structural issues? Not necessarily; small surface cracks are common and often cosmetic, while larger or expanding cracks may indicate deeper concerns.
How can garage cracks be repaired? Repairs typically involve sealing surface cracks or applying reinforcement methods for more significant damage.
Is crack repair necessary for maintaining garage integrity? Yes, addressing cracks promptly helps prevent further damage and maintains the stability of the garage structure.
